We just wrapped up a two-day wakesurf and wakeboard event in Columbus Ohio. To my knowledge the first ever wakesurfing event in the state. In all we had 21 wakessurfing entries. Ohio, Indiana, and Michigan were represented. One family drove up from their summer home in Tennessee to compete. The age range was from 8 to 46. Kaley's parents emailed me a few times asking if there would be a division for children - for their 8-year old daughter. Well, Kaley took top honors, at the tender age of eight, in pig tails, and with a tooth fairy smile?

The Batteries in our camera died in the middle of the awards, if you were there and have pictures, please contact me.

The results are:
Men’s Novice
1st Mike Ash
2nd Bryon Hourt
3rd Brian Miller

Women’s Novice
Kelly Sullivan

Mens’s Advanced
1st Todd Tucker
2nd Scott Sutterfield
3rd Bill Lanz

Women’s Advanced
Kaley Gordon
Jordan Lausch
Ali Lausch
